Pet-friendly flight to Chiang Mai is a howling success


CHIANG MAI (The Nation/Asia News Network): The pet-friendly chartered flight 'Paws Can Fly Season 1' flew around 50 dogs with their delighted owners from Bangkok to Chiang Mai for a frolicking time.

The Nok Air flight, which flew from Don Mueang International Airport in Bangkok to Chiang Mai International Airport on Tuesday (Aug 30), carried several popular influencers and actresses.
